The Pricey Trap of External Hunting:

Recruiting from outside is like hunting in unfamiliar territory – expensive, time-consuming, and riddled with unknowns. Studies reveal that hiring an external candidate can cost up to 120% of their annual salary. Worse, it disrupts team dynamics and delays critical decisions as the new hire navigates the organizational jungle. L&D, on the other hand, cultivates talent within, nurturing familiar faces with the necessary skills and knowledge to seamlessly step into key roles. It's like having a stable of trained horses ready to take the reins, eliminating the need for costly expeditions.

Untapped Gems in Your Own Backyard:

Every organization has its own "high-potential" employees, individuals brimming with talent waiting to be unlocked. L&D acts as the key, providing them with tailored training programs, mentorship opportunities, and stretch assignments that hone their skills and equip them for leadership roles. This not only ensures a smooth transition when key positions become vacant but also boosts employee engagement and loyalty. Who wouldn't feel valued knowing their organization invests in their growth?

When Linchpins Leave, the System Shakes:

Every organization has its "linchpins" – individuals whose expertise and knowledge hold critical functions together. The loss of such a person can be catastrophic, leaving behind a void that disrupts operations and demoralizes teams. L&D can act as a safety net, identifying and grooming potential successors who can seamlessly step into these crucial roles, minimizing the impact of such departures and ensuring organizational stability.
